W3C home > Mailing lists > Public > www-style@w3.org > March 2013

Re: [css3-grid-layout] Syntax of track lists wrt named grid lines

From: Tab Atkins Jr. <jackalmage@gmail.com>
Date: Mon, 18 Mar 2013 18:52:46 -0700
Message-ID: <CAAWBYDDZO6NsF5xK4+caY87Y+Lsk=HV=n4yDoLXqke2o4MUorw@mail.gmail.com>
To: "Linss, Peter" <peter.linss@hp.com>
Cc: www-style list <www-style@w3.org>
On Mon, Mar 18, 2013 at 6:42 PM, Linss, Peter <peter.linss@hp.com> wrote:
> The problem with using idents for line names is that you run in to potential collisions with other idents in all the places where lines names can be used. For starters, you're precluding the use of 'span' and 'auto', which is straight-forard enough, but it prevents us from ever adding any other ident values to grid-start/-end/...
>
> I know there's history of using user-defined idents in other places, but I seem to recall a resolution where we agreed this was a dangerous practice and in the future user defined names should be strings (or wrapped in function tokens) to avoid collisions.

It doesn't quite prevent us from doing it, it just means we need to be
reasonable sure about compat risk.

If we ever did resolve that, we've continued to violate it.  For
example, counter-style names from @counter-style.

~TJ
Received on Tuesday, 19 March 2013 01:53:34 GMT

This archive was generated by hypermail 2.3.1 : Tuesday, 26 March 2013 17:21:07 GMT